Android

To update your game, just go to the Android Market where you'll be prompted to download the latest version.  If your device is not on the list of supported devices, we recommend subscribing to the following article to be automatically notified via email when more models are added:

12/19/11: Version 1.1

We're pleased to report that the Android version of Grand Theft Auto III: 10 Year Anniversary Edition has been updated today to version 1.1 with a number of fixes along with new support for the Droid Bionic, Galaxy Nexus and Samsung Galaxy S II devices.

This update includes:

  • A fix so that immediately skipping cutscenes will no longer cause issues
  • The addition of PowerVR GPU support
  • Improved shader error handing and a few additional technical fixes

12/22/11: Version 1.2

A new update for #GTA3 (v1.2) is live on Android Market to address Xperia Play issues + add support for the DROID RAZR.

1/25/12: Version 1.3

  • Added support for Medion Lifetab and the Asus Transformer Prime
  • Integrated with Immersion Haptic Vibration Feedback
  • Tailor your visual experience with new video display settings
  • Improved controls for supported gamepads
  • Improved controls for Xperia Play
  • Game can now be installed to an SD card
  • Gamestop Wireless Game Controller fully supported.
  • Additional technical fixes

 

iOS

To update, head into the App Store, select 'Updates' and download the game. Officially supported iOS devices include iPad 1 & 2, iPhone 4 & 4S and iPod touch 4th Generation.

2/29/12: Version 1.1

  • Optimized memory usage for older devices and some minor bug fixes
